Text

(a)The following shall apply to all political subdivisions subject to this part:
(1)(A) For political subdivision employees hired on or after May 22, 2014, the political subdivision may freeze, suspend or modify benefits, employee contributions, plan terms and design on a prospective basis;
(B)Subdivision (a)(1)(A) does not affect any judicial precedents or statutory law as they apply to employees who were employed prior to May 22, 2014;
(2)For any pension plan that is funded below sixty percent (60%), the political subdivision shall not establish a benefit enhancement until it has received written approval by the state treasurer. Legislative History

Amended by 2020 Tenn. Acts, ch. 783, s 3, eff. 7/15/2020. Amended by 2018 Tenn. Acts, ch. 681, s 2, eff. 4/12/2018. Added by 2014 Tenn. Acts, ch. 990,s 3, eff. 5/22/2014.
